AccountMate’s Payroll automates the payroll processes including the set up of records for salaried, hourly and time card/piece work employees and the set up of records for independent contractors, and pay them over a variety of pay periods according to their pay/employment status. Within this flexible system, you can withhold deductions using a variety of methods. You can record additional payments, such as bonuses, for any employee and include it in the same paycheck or separate checks. The system automatically calculates payroll taxes and prints payroll tax returns, W-2 forms, and 1099 forms. This module also facilitates electronic payments of employee and federal tax deposits.

Instant Access to Employee Information
You can drill down on the Employee # label to have instant access to an individual employee's records, including salary, benefits, W-4 and deduction information, as well as earnings by quarter. This breadth of information is helpful when entering payroll data and applying payroll for payment.


Automatic Warning to Prevent Duplication of Payments
The system automatically alerts you if a time card has already been created for any given employee on the current day. The system also alerts you if there is an unpaid applied payment for the individual for whom the user is trying to apply a payment. In addition, you can review the amounts applied for payment. This helps you avoid duplicate payments.

Management Can Track Employee Time
You can use the Payroll module to track regular time, overtime, holiday time, sick time, vacation time, and personal time - by employee, department, and state.

Additional State Tax Codes Can Be Set Up
You can define up to three additional tax codes for each tax state, and you can set up employee and employer tax rates – and a wage base – for each tax. This is useful for setting up taxes that affect all employees in a state but are not hard-wired into the system.

Supports EFTPS Payments
The system supports the electronic deposit of both Form 940 and 941 federal payroll taxes via the Electronic Federal Tax Payment System. This enables you to deposit payroll taxes directly with the IRS, avoiding trips to the bank.


Post After-the-Fact Payrolls
The Post After-the-Fact Payroll function enables you to record checks generated outside the system without first using the Apply function to calculate exact earnings, deductions, withholdings and net payments. This is useful when system-generated data is not available at the time the checks are printed or written.

Unlimited Deductions
You can set up an unlimited number of deductions, and then apply any number of them to any employee. You can specify whether a deduction is to be withheld as a fixed amount per pay period, a percentage rate or an amount per hour worked. You can also specify that deductions such as contributions to 401(k) plans are to offset taxable wages. Deductions can be customized for each employee and can be overwritten when payrolls are applied for payment.

1099 Payments
TThe system supports 1099 payments to independent contractors, tracks 1099 payments, and produces the appropriate 1099-Misc. forms. You can use the Payroll module to print out 1099 forms for the prior year as well as for the current year.

Apply Payroll/Payments Automatically or Manually
The automatic payroll application function integrated into the Payroll module is fast, since payment is immediately applied for all employees/contractors in the selected range; however, the manual application option allows you to review, amend, apply or skip application of the payment for each person. Either way, AccountMate 6.5 for LAN's Payroll module calculates earnings, deductions, and withholding amounts for employees.

Salary and Performance Review Set Up
You can enter salary and performance review dates on employee records – then generate reports based on this information. You can see at a glance which employees are coming up for review, as well as when a specific employee is scheduled for review.

Supports Handwritten Checks
The Handwritten Check function supplies the amounts needed to issue out-of-system payroll checks when you cannot wait for the regular computer-check printing cycle. It also records the issuance of these checks. This flexible option makes it easy for you to issue emergency payroll checks - it only requires that the amounts be first applied for payment so that the checks can be printed or written using the exact, system-calculated wages, deductions, withholdings, and net pay amounts.

Drill Down is Available on All Major Fields
The Payroll module's drill down feature allows you to instantly access or set up records for all major field labels, including the Employee #, Dept #, Job Title, and General Ledger Account ID labels where applicable.

Generate a Variety of Check Reports
You can generate registers of both computer checks and handwritten checks using the Payroll module. You can also include or exclude checks that contain overtime or other wages, and you can show or omit information about deductions and hours worked. Using this option, you can also generate summary check reports; electronic payment reports; and reports on voided, outstanding, and cancelled checks.

Payroll Costs Can Be Distributed to Multiple GL Accounts
When the Payroll module is linked to the General Ledger, you can set up unlimited General Ledger accounts and default wage/tax distribution percentages on employee records. This makes distribution to multiple accounts easy, and the information can be overwritten when entering time card/piece work data.

Recalculation of FUTA/SUTA amounts
You can recalculate your FUTA and SUTA liabilities. This feature is vital in cases where you receive notices of changes in our FUTA and SUTA tax rates and wage bases after you have issued paychecks.

Recalculate SUTA amount for changes in the SUTA Maximum Wages
The Recalculate FUTA/SUTA Amount function is enhanced such that SUTA amount will be recalculated if SUTA Maximum Wages changes. Previously, only the SUTA rate change was considered. Unlike rate changes, changes in the SUTA Maximum Wages may affect checks issued within the current calendar year.

Integration with General Ledger and Bank Reconciliation Modules
Integration with the General Ledger module allows you to transfer easily payroll transactions to the General Ledger through the Transfer Data to GL and Period-End Closing functions. You can also control whether a transaction must be transferred to the General Ledger.

Integration with the Bank Reconciliation module enables all checks recorded in this module to appear automatically in the reconciliation for the related bank account. The Bank Reconciliation function shows the transaction descriptions and references for ease in identification. During reconciliation, you can choose whether to show employee names as the payees associated with PR check amounts.
